You can reduce the cost of your homeowner's insurance by doing two things. A residence alarm system is one of those two things. Carrying this out can lower your superior up to 5% annually. You have got to demonstrate confirmation in your insurance carrier you do have one of those, nonetheless. Mount new smoke cigarettes sensors in your house. This might save up to ten percent yearly.

When searching for homeowner's insurance coverage, make sure you get a insurance policy that offers confirmed replacing value insurance policy. Which means that your insurance policy will surely re-establish your house if this have been fully damaged. As design charges raise with time, it may cost a lot more to create your property now than it performed whenever your home was new. Certain replacement policies take in these costs.

Don not, below any scenarios, allow your danger insurance on the the place to find lapse. Most mortgage companies possess a clause inside the agreement you approved that should you don't pay out it, they will discover a new policy for it, sparing no expense, and charge a fee for the premium. It is going to generally be at very least increase the things you have been having to pay just before. You might be happier performing no matter what you should in order to keep your coverage current.

If you have leisure amenities with your backyard such as pools, hot tubs, trampolines, or other contraptions that will likely lead to injury, this can boost your insurance costs, often by 10 percent or more. Look at this when making a decision about investing in a home using these issues, or introducing them to it.

Deduct value of the territory that your home is created on. It is actually very costly and pointless to pay for the terrain that it is created on. You can expect to save a good bit of dollars by simply determining the land's worthy of and subtracting it from the sum that you are currently covering on your own property insurance insurance policy.

When you are filing for fireplace insurance coverage, make certain your insurance policy handles problems experienced to cars during a flame. Many people will not do that and find yourself experiencing to purchase vehicle damage following a blaze. In case your car does took place to obtain damaged, make sure to place the variety and volume of damages on the declare.
